Description
Technical Field
The utility model relates to a methanol fuel marine fuel supply double-walled pipe.
Background
Some ships adopt methanol fuel gas as power fuel, and traditional marine fuel supply pipe generally adopts the single tube to carry out the transport of methanol fuel, however the pipeline easily appears leaking after using for a certain time under the effect of inside atmospheric pressure, or the welding seam also can have the possibility of leaking when the welding seam appears in the connection. Methanol is flammable and explosive, has strong corrosivity and toxicity, and is seriously harmful when leaked.

It is seen by above-mentioned scheme, through the front end of outer tube and end all with the outer wall of inner tube is fixed and sealed cooperation, and then forms a sealed pipeline space, through the front end of outer tube sets up the air intake to it is right continuously through outside forced draught blower the outer tube with pipeline space air supply between the inner tube reaches and to leak the gas and dredge the outside effect of boats and ships in the very first time when the condition appears leaking, and then avoids the gas to cause serious harm at the inboard diffusion of ship. The methanol concentration detector is arranged on the outer pipe to detect the methanol concentration in the pipe space between the outer pipe and the inner pipe, and then the leakage condition is obtained. The supporting frame is arranged to enable the outer pipe to be mounted more firmly and reliably.
Preferably, the inner pipe is provided with a valve accessory, the outer pipe comprises a first pipe section and a second pipe section, the first pipe section and the second pipe section are respectively positioned at two ends of the valve accessory, and the first pipe section and the second pipe section are communicated through a connecting pipe.
It can be seen from the above-mentioned scheme that all can set up the valve annex through gas conveying pipeline, through adopting the sectional type the outer tube carries out the linking of valve annex department ensures to leak the continuity that the gas dredges the pipeline space.
preferably, the inner pipe and the outer pipe are both made of 316L stainless steel material.
According to the scheme, the pipeline leakage caused by strong corrosivity of methanol fuel is avoided through the 316L stainless steel material, and meanwhile, the conditions that the inner pipe and the outer pipe are welded to form a closed environment are met through the inner pipe and the outer pipe which are made of the same material.
Preferably, the inner pipe and the outer pipe are welded and fixed into a whole.
The supporting frame comprises a ring body and a plurality of connecting rods arranged on the periphery of the ring body, the connecting rods are uniformly distributed along the circumferential direction of the ring body, and the inner diameter of the ring body is matched with the outer wall of the inner pipe.
According to the scheme, the support frame is fixed on the inner pipe through the ring body, and the support frame is connected with the inner pipe and the outer pipe through the connecting rod.
Preferably, the ring body is provided with four connecting rods, and the outer end faces of the connecting rods are in contact with the inner wall of the outer pipe.
Preferably, the methanol concentration detector is electrically connected with an external alarm.
According to the scheme, the methanol concentration detector is electrically connected with the external alarm, so that when the methanol concentration in the pipeline space between the outer pipe and the inner pipe is too high, a crew is reminded to execute safety measures in time.

Detailed Description
As shown in fig. 1, in this embodiment, the utility model discloses an inner tube 1 and outer tube 2, the outer tube 2 cover is established 1 outside of inner tube, the front end and the end of outer tube 2 all with the fixed and sealed cooperation of outer wall of inner tube 1, the front end of outer tube 2 is equipped with air intake 3, air intake 3 and outside forced draught blower intercommunication, the end of outer tube 2 is provided with the air outlet, air outlet and the outside atmospheric environment intercommunication of boats and ships, be provided with methyl alcohol concentration detector 4 on the outer tube 2, inner tube 1 with be provided with support frame 5 between the outer tube 2.
The joint weld of the inner pipe 1 is positioned in a closed pipeline space formed by welding the inner pipe 1 and the outer pipe 2, when leakage occurs at the welding position, leaked fuel gas is discharged in the closed pipeline space, and the leaked fuel gas is discharged out of the ship by the airflow from the air inlet 3.
In this embodiment, a valve accessory 6 is disposed on the wall of the inner pipe 1, the outer pipe 2 includes a first pipe section 2a and a second pipe section 2b, the first pipe section 2a and the second pipe section 2b are respectively located at two ends of the valve accessory 6, and the first pipe section 2a and the second pipe section 2b are communicated through a connecting pipe.
In the present embodiment, the inner tube 1 and the outer tube 2 are both made of 316L stainless steel material.
In the present embodiment, the inner tube 1 and the outer tube 2 are welded and fixed integrally.
In this embodiment, the supporting frame 5 includes a ring body 5a and a plurality of connecting rods 5b arranged on the periphery of the ring body 5a, the connecting rods 5b are uniformly distributed along the circumferential direction of the ring body 5a, and the inner diameter of the ring body 5a is matched with the outer wall of the inner tube 1.
In the present embodiment, the ring body 5a is provided with four connecting rods 5b, and the outer end surfaces of the connecting rods 5b are in contact with the inner wall of the outer tube 2.
In the present embodiment, the methanol concentration detector 4 is electrically connected to an external alarm.
The utility model discloses a theory of operation:
When the inner pipe 1 leaks, the leaked fuel gas is discharged into the closed pipe space, and the leaked fuel gas is discharged to the outside of the ship through the air outlet by the air flow from the air inlet 3.
When the concentration of the fuel gas in the closed pipeline space is too high, the methanol concentration detector 4 triggers the external alarm, and the external alarm gives an alarm sound and gives a red light alarm.
